rays hell
10-06-2015, 06:16 PM
I have a pre 13 comfort seat. I don't know if the newer comfort seats come with the plug to remove for the BRP backrest.
But in the directions it says to measure from the center of the crown two inches back to find the spot to cut the seat.
There is a video on Youtube that shows the install procedure. You can see there how to measure and find the spot to make the cut.
But the stock seat sits the driver 2" closer to the handlebars.
So, I measured 1/2-3/4" from the crown.

I hope this helps

robmorg
01-10-2016, 05:43 PM
Utopia's backrest will fit on either a ComfortSeat or regular seat. I have one installed on a ComfortSeat. That requires one of the brackets to be slightly longer, so you just have to tell them which seat you are installing it on.
